Core responsibilities
Provide targeted language support to help multilingual learners develop english proficiency in speaking, listening, reading, and writing. Administer proficiency screeners, develop individual language acquisition plans, and collaborate with teachers to implement sheltered instruction strategies.
Requirements summary
Candidates must hold a bachelor's degree and a current state teaching certificate. A valid esol or esl certification and the ability to pass a criminal background check are required.
